Adobong Pusit, or squid adobo, is a classic Filipino dish that showcases the beloved adobo cooking method in a unique and flavorful way. Adobo, often considered the national dish of the Philippines, is a cooking technique that involves simmering meat, seafood, or vegetables in a savory and tangy sauce made from vinegar, soy sauce, garlic, and peppercorns.
Another variation of the delectable Filipino adobo recipe. This pork adobo with coke recipe is very soft and yummy. The dish is made of pork belly, soaked in marinade sauce, and simmered with Coca-Cola drinks and water for the right period of time until the meat gets soft. The coke drink ingredients give the meal a delicious flavor and a hint of sweetness. This version of adobo tastes a little sweeter than the traditional adobo recipe. The taste is quite similar to that of humba bisaya, a delicious authentic bisaya dish.

Pork chop asado recipe is a great dish; it is meaty and delicious. Our recipe is a variation of a popular authentic Filipino pork asado dish. Our asado recipe is prepared with pork chops along with certain spices and cooked until tender, then turned into a delectable dish. The asado is quite similar to the pork adobo and humba recipes from the Visayan region, though they taste a bit different, but both of them are so delicious.
